  • Technological Innovations: Advancements in organic light-emitting diodes (OLEDs) have enabled the development of flexible and lightweight displays, leading to their increased adoption in consumer electronics such as smartphones and televisions.

Market Dynamics:

  • Drivers:

    • Demand for Flexible Electronics: The growing interest in flexible and wearable electronic devices has significantly boosted the organic electronics market.

    • Energy Efficiency: Organic electronics are known for their energy-efficient properties, making them attractive for applications in renewable energy and environmentally friendly technologies.

  • Restraints:

    • Material Stability: Challenges related to the stability and reliability of organic materials can hinder the performance and lifespan of organic electronic devices.

    • Production Costs: High production costs and scalability issues pose challenges to the widespread adoption of organic electronics.

Segment Analysis by Application:

  • Displays: Organic electronics are extensively used in OLED displays, which are increasingly integrated into smartphones, televisions, and wearable devices.

  • Lighting: OLED lighting applications are gaining traction due to their energy efficiency and design flexibility, making them suitable for various lighting solutions.

  • Solar Cells: Organic photovoltaics (OPVs) are being developed for renewable energy applications, offering lightweight and flexible solar energy solutions.
